Thomas Kalmaku is an Eskimo originally from Alaska. He moved to Coast City, California and worked for Ferris Aircrafts. He became friends with Hal Jordan, the Green Lantern. He married Tegra and has two children named Keith and Michele Kari.

During the events of Millennium, the Guardian Herupa Hando Hu and the Zamaron Nadia Safir came to Earth to find ten people to propel the planet into the new millennium. Thomas was the ninth to be visited by Herupa and Nadia. Just like all of the chosen, Herupa and Nadia told him in their language: “We have chosen ten people on Earth to advance the human race, and one of the ten is you! The heroes and heroines of Earth, join us in asking you to leave this life and enter the future!” However, Thomas did not want to help them because it meant leaving his family, so he kindly refused their offering.

Nicknamed "Pieface", Thomas often accompanied Hal Jordan during his many silver-age adventures.

His mother Katy Kalmaku was saved by Alan Scott before the Japanese Army invaded the Aleutian Islands (Attu Island) in Young All-Stars #8.

As a mechanic and ally to Hal Jordan, Tom develops a working friendship with Carol Ferris.

Last Will and Testament of Hal Jordan

After Hal Jordan's death, Tom learns that his best friend did truly care about him, and entrusted him with a small piece of his power, that Tom uses to save a small piece of Hal Jordan's soul.
